About Ravinder Kumar
Ravinder Kumar is a scholar working on Plant Science, Surgery, Biomedical Engineering, Insect Science and Agronomy and Crop Science, having authored 71 papers that have together received 630 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Sugarcane Cultivation and Processing (41 papers), Natural Products and Biological Research (26 papers), Rice Cultivation and Yield Improvement (13 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(13 papers), Genetics and Plant Breeding (11 papers), Plant responses to water stress (7 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(7 papers) and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Horticulture (17 citations), Plant Science (535 citations), Biochemistry (28 citations), Nutrition and Dietetics (44 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(113 citations). Ravinder Kumar has collaborated with scholars based in India, South Korea and United States. Frequent co-authors include Mintu Ram Meena, C. Appunu, Bakshi Ram, Neeraj Kulshreshtha, G. Hemaprabha, Jyoti Nishad, Sarika Sarika, Charanjit Kaur, S. Akila Parvathy Dharshini and S. Vasantha. Their work appears in journals such as Sustainability, Industrial Crops and Products, BMC Plant Biology, Scientific Reports and Food Research International.
